9 months agoYeah the process of outsourcing animation tends to iron out any quirks, in order to minimise retakes. In my opinion it leads to kind of bland, unexpressive animation, and it's a waste of some really exceptional animators.

9 months agohell, this is an issue with Anime even to this very day where animators of outsource houses, even the veteran ones (or companies like Madhouse, TMS or J.C. Staff when they do contract work for another company) will often leave out their animators when it comes time to credit them for a given episode. Think that, but amplified ten-fold for Western outsourcing.
I have never really gotten why this is, whether its politics, credit restrictions or just the industry, regardless of region, just being ungrateful clowns to the people who actually work on their shows. Hell, when it comes to Japanese outsourcing, I wouldn't be surprised if the lead studio for these Western cartoons (be they Toei, TMS, KKC&D, et.al) never kept track of who did what themselves. I certainly know Toei rarely gave proper credit to its outsource partners on their anime titles back in the 70s and 80s.
